Secondary Glazing Secondary glazing is an excellent solution for homeowners since it can increase the efficiency of older homes without having to replace the windows that were originally installed. It also helps reduce the amount of noise pollution. It is a good option for a listed structure or property that is situated in conservation areas, since it will let you keep the beauty of your home while improving its thermal efficiency. It can also be used to lower your energy bills. Your home will be more comfortable and cozy. It traps air between the window glass and the secondary glass, which minimizes the loss of heat through the primary glass. Secondary glazing is a great choice because it can fit to any window regardless of its size or shape. Secondary glazing can be fitted on casements, sash windows or sliding sashes. It is also available in a variety styles, shapes and materials to match the property's look. It is essential to correctly set secondary glazing in the right place when installing it. It is recommended to consult an expert for assistance with this. They can determine the appropriate thickness of glass for your building and then fit it correctly, as well as help you to seal it effectively. Secondary glazing can be used to increase the soundproofing capacity of your home in addition to its insulation benefits. This is especially beneficial in buildings in which noise from outside sources like trains, planes or traffic is a major source of noise. Secondary glazing has more options than double glazing repair-glazed units for soundproofing. Based on the nature of the noise, you may have to upgrade to thicker glass panels and acoustic seals in order to achieve the best results.
